Job Description

Build a Career That Makes a Real Difference Ready to turn your ambition into lasting impact? At New York Life, you won't just build a career—you'll help individuals and families protect what matters most while creating a future you're proud of. We're seeking a Bilingual Financial Rep to join our growing team at the Greater San Jose General Office. If you're fluent in English and proficient in Spanish, Korean, Hindi, Chinese, Tagalog, or Vietnamese—and passionate about serving diverse communities—we want to hear from you. Why New York Life? Upside Earning Potential Benefit from a competitive compensation structure with performance-based incentives that reward your drive and success. Flexibility That Fits Your Life Take control of your schedule and build a career that aligns with your personal and professional goals. Clear Path for Growth Accelerate your career with structured advancement opportunities, industry-leading training, and continuous support every step of the way. Your Role As a Financial Professional, you'll provide tailored financial guidance and access to a broad range of insurance and investment solutions—helping clients make confident decisions through every stage of life. The Impact You'll Make You'll design personalized strategies that help clients build, protect, and preserve their wealth—while creating meaningful relationships and making a difference in your community. Start something meaningful today. Join New York Life and build a career that grows with you—professionally, financially, and personally.
Compensation:
$108,800 at plan commission annually
Responsibilities:
Develop trusted advisory relationships to help clients achieve financial security and long-term success Design and implement comprehensive financial strategies spanning risk management, retirement, investments, and wealth preservation Analyze clients' financial positions to create actionable, goal-driven financial plans Empower clients through education and strategic guidance to make confident financial decisions Proactively adjust financial strategies to reflect market conditions and life transitions Maintain strict adherence to compliance standards while delivering high-quality client service Drive business growth through referrals, relationship-building, and community outreach Pursue ongoing education to strengthen expertise and enhance client outcomes
Qualifications:
Language Requirements Fluency in English Proficiency in at least one of the following languages: Spanish, Korean, Hindi, Chinese, Tagalog, or Vietnamese Core Values Strong alignment with the concept of "seeds," representing growth, nurturing, and long-term personal and professional development A compassionate mindset and a genuine desire to help others Ideal Candidate Profile Dedicated, open-minded, and driven to succeed Strong interpersonal and communication skills Empathetic and compassionate when working with clients Self-motivated with a strong desire for continuous learning and career advancement Excellent relationship-building abilities and outstanding people skills Eligibility Requirements Must be authorized to work in the U.S. with a valid U.S. passport, green card, or Immigrated EAD (OPT/F-1 visa holders not eligible) About Company New York Life's mission is to provide financial security and peace of mind through our insurance, annuity, and investment solutions.
